There’s nothing like hanging out with pals and enjoying the end of a long day at work with tasty food and cold drinks. Looking for a new place to meet up with your friends? Here are a few things to consider when you pick a bar and restaurant in NYC:

Start with the food

Is the food tasty and fresh? Is it all sorts of wonderful that you can definitely see yourself and your friends coming back for more? Then that’s a good reason to put that restaurant on top of your list. It’s always a good thing when you find a restaurant you love, since that easily adds to your list of takeout options.

Check out the staff

How does the staff treat you? Are they helpful and polite? Friendly and courteous? Wonderful and attentive to your needs? While excellent food is always a big draw for customers, if you have to deal with rude and inept staff, that’s going to take a lot out of the pleasure you would have gotten from the meal. Save yourself the stress and trouble by scouting around for a bar and restaurant in NYC with better-trained staff.

Consider the location

You’ll want to pick one that’s accessible to you and your friends, says Delishably. It can be tough to swing by often if the place is a bit of a distance from where you live or work. However, if you love the restaurant’s food to bits, distance really isn’t going to be enough to deter you from coming back.

Assess hygiene standards

You’ll want to consider picking a place that’s hygienic so you can order and eat to your heart’s content, without worrying about whether the food you eat is clean and sanitary. This way, you can enjoy your meals to the fullest.
